Fry adds to weekly accolades

FARMINGTON -- University of Maine at Farmington senior forward Sean Fry (Jay, ME) was named the Maine Men's Basketball Coaches and Writers Association Player of the Week as announced today.

Fry was named the North Atlantic Conference Men's Basketball Player of the Week on Monday. Story

Fry powered the Beavers to a 64-61 win over in-state rival St. Joseph's with 26 points and 10 rebounds. Fry hit a pair of 3-pointers and was 8 for 10 from the foul line in the win.

Fry was an All-NAC Second Team honoree last season as a junior.

The Beavers were selected fifth in the weekly MMBCWA coaches poll. Farmington received nine points. The poll was filled out by Bowdoin College (32), Colby (31), Husson (16) and the University of Southern Maine (15).

Farmington (2-1) is scheduled to host NAC and in-state foe Thomas College on Wednesday at Dearborn Gym. The women's game is tabbed for a 5:30 p.m. start with the men to follow.
